Why is ScriptOutput returning empty values in my QAction?

Solved132 views17th June 2025#automationScipt Automation QAction

Hello,

I’m working with a QAction in DataMiner where I call an Automation Script using ExecuteScriptMessage.
The script runs fine, and I'm using engine.AddScriptOutput(...) to define specific return values.

____________________________________________________________

Here's how I call the script in my QAction:

var response = protocol.ExecuteScript(message);

string fullMessage = response.ScriptOutput["1"];
string startInfo = response.ScriptOutput["StartTaskUpdated"];

____________________________________________________________

Here's what I do inside the Automation Script:

engine.AddScriptOutput("1", "Example1");
engine.AddScriptOutput("StartTaskUpdated", "Example2");

____________________________________________________________

Even though the script executes successfully, all keys in response.ScriptOutput are either null or "(not set)" in my QAction.

What could be causing this?
Is there a requirement that prevents ScriptOutput from populating correctly? Am I not referencing the content properly?

Some documentation or a code snippet would help me a lot!

Hi David,

Did you set the script options? If not, we likely do not wait for the script to complete before accessing the output. To avoid this, I believe you need to set the option "DEFER:False".

Class ExecuteScriptMessage | DataMiner Docs

Hope this helps!
